The upgraded version, Mars 2.0, has been redesigned to offer what customers' evolving demands include such as increased motor power, longer battery life and shorter charging time, spring shock absorber and even easier foldability. The Mars 2.0 also provides users with the amount of traction needed to take on corners at a faster speed without any risk of slipping or sliding. This folding all-terrain e-Bike is built for adventure, with 20-inch x 4-inch fat tires, improving shock absorption, giving better stability, and suspension off-road. It is also lightweight - making it perfect for carrying upstairs or throwing it into the back of your car or truck to take on vacation with you. Besides these, it also comes with a new DIY Pegboard at the back seat that allows you to decide what and how to carry on your ride. The upgraded Mars 2.0 can travel up to 28 mph, getting you to where you need to be quicker, but without sacrificing safety. Traveling up to 45 miles per charge (PAS mode)72.5km on a single charge, . the removable 48V/12w.5A battery comes with a 54.6V/2A charger. It gives you full power in less than 6 hours. The Mars 2.0 also offers mechanical brakes and pedal assistance 0-5. For a folding e-Bike, the Mars 2.0 has a slimmer frame (75lbs) that can fit comfortably in your trunk or be taken on the bus or train if you're commuting. Its 15 inch high step through frame is great for riders from 5'5" to 6'3". Other notable features include an LCD display, alloy wheels and 20 inch x 4 inch fat tires. The Mars 2.0 e-Bike by Heybike features front and rear lights, making them safer to ride in the early morning and later in the evening. This e-Bike also comes with front and rear fenders, to keep your clothes clean.

The XPeak 2.0 is a newly upgraded version of the trail-ready, all-terrain eBike. Tested to the most aggressive safety standards for off-road eBikes (eMTB), and named by Men's Health as a "Best of Sweat" winner in the 2025 Tech Awards, the XPeak 2.0 now comes standard with an industry-leading torque sensor that provides an exceptional riding experience with intuitive and controlled power delivery at each pedal stroke. Combined with the 750-watt Stealth M24 motor (1310 Peak) for a powerful yet hushed motor experience, the XPeak 2.0 delivers the muscle and speed to take on any terrain as a Class 1, 2, or 3 eBike. Additional upgrades include a newly designed hydroformed frame, a larger 203mm front disc brake rotor for maximum stopping power, an integrated color display, lock-on grips, and an 8-speed Shimano drivetrain.

Absolutely love this thing. Ships with throttle restricted to 20mph. Can be adjusted in settings to hit around 28 in pedal assist. Wish the brakes were hydraulic at those speeds. Shipping was two days and no damage; however rear tire had lower tire pressure than the front did. No leaks in it and I found the ride actually a little more comfortable lowering it some in the rear. Double check the spacing on the brake pads in the calipers. Mine were both running a little but was a quick adjustment. Battery will drain after like 2 hours of riding at max speed; however, I like pedal assist 2 mode(13-15ish) it’ll make it almost the whole 48. I suggest a bag for the rack. I keep bungees in it. Use the bike often to run to the store to grab small items and to the gas station to get a bundle of firewood to bungee down to the rack. Works fine. I’ve bungees fishing poles and gear to it and road right along the river fishing. The off road is amazing. Definitely purchase a handlebar bike mirror for the left side if you are in the US. I got a meachow brand that folds so when I bring it in for the night or lock it next to other bikes it’s not dinging around. I really wish I would have purchased two. I just hit the 250 mile mark on the odometer and have barely had it a month and a half. It is a lot bigger in person. I’m 5’8” and just barely raised the seat so I can get the suspension feel in the ride and I can hardly reach the ground full vertical. Folding is fun but it’s so heavy (90lbs) I don’t bother much easier to use the handle to lift it while it’s not folded.

This bike performs well. Goes up hills with ease. Plenty of torque. The display is pretty nice. I have put almost 200 miles on it in the past week and a half since I bought it. Every time I'm out someone stops me to ask about it. The assembly was pretty easy and didn't take long. Overall it's a great bike. The brakes are good enough for me but most people think they are a little weak. The brakes were out of adjustment out of the box. I had to YouTube how to adjust them. They were rubbing and making allot of noise when not even using them. They are a little noisy when using which will make people turn there head. The seat is pretty uncomfortable. You will probably want to replace it. It will probably be my first upgrade. I average about 22 miles per charge. That is mostly using throttle so don't expect anything close to the advertised because it is a pretty small battery. I would like a second one but they are sold out. Hopefully they will have batteries again. This bike is a lot of fun. I use it on almost a daily basis.
